What are Cake Pop Monsters?

Cake pop monsters are essentially cake pops that have been transformed into cute, funny, or even slightly spooky monster figures. They are made by baking a standard cake batter, rolling it into balls, dipping them in melted candy coating, and then decorating them with various candies, icing, and other edible embellishments to create the monster features. The result is a delightful fusion of sweet treat and playful artistry.

The concept of cake pops was first popularized by Bakerella, a food blogger who introduced the world to these bite-sized delights in 2008. However, it was the addition of monster features that took cake pops to a whole new level of fun. The idea of cake pop monsters gained traction on social media, with bakers and cake enthusiasts sharing their creations, inspiring others to get creative in the kitchen.

Making cake pop monsters is a fun and straightforward process that involves a few simple steps. Here's a basic recipe to get you started:

Ingredients Amount
Cake mix (and ingredients required on the box) 1 box
Candy coating 16 oz
Candies, icing, and other edible decorations As needed

First, bake the cake according to the box instructions. Once cooled, crumble the cake into a large bowl. Add about 1/2 cup of frosting and mix until the cake mixture holds together when squeezed. Roll the mixture into balls, place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, and refrigerate for about 30 minutes.

Melt the candy coating in the microwave or using a double boiler. Dip the cake balls into the coating, using a fork to coat them completely. Tap the fork on the side of the bowl to remove any excess coating, then place the cake pop on the parchment paper to harden. Once the coating is set, it's time to decorate your monster!

The fun part about cake pop monsters is the endless possibilities for decoration. Here are a few ideas to get you started:

  • Use different colored candy melts to create a variety of monster skin tones.
  • Add googly eyes, candy teeth, and other edible features to bring your monster to life.
  • Use icing to draw on monster features, such as mouths, tongues, and horns.
  • Create texture with sprinkles, coconut flakes, or crushed cookies to give your monster a unique look.
  • Use edible markers to draw on details or write funny monster names.

Don't be afraid to get creative and have fun with your monster designs. There are no rules when it comes to cake pop monsters - the wackier, the better!
